Rainwater collecting, monitoring and discharging integration equipment
The invention discloses rainwater collecting, monitoring and discharging integration equipment. The rainwater collecting, monitoring and discharging integration equipment comprises an equipment shellbody, a rainwater conveying pipeline which extends into the equipment shell body, a first rainwater collecting pool, a second rainwater collecting pool, a rainwater purifying pool, a rainwater discharging pool and a PLC, the first rainwater collecting pool, the second rainwater collecting pool, the rainwater purifying pool and the rainwater discharging pool are arranged in the equipment shell body, the rainwater conveying pipeline comprises a main conveying pipeline, a first branch pipeline, a second branch pipeline and a third branch pipeline, an electromagnetic induction flow meter, a chemical oxygen demand (COD) detection sensor, a suspended solid (SS) detection sensor, a PH value detection sensor, a ammonia nitrogen detection sensor and a total phosphorus detection sensor are arrangedon the main conveying pipeline. According to the rainwater collecting, monitoring and discharging integration equipment, firstly, turbid rainwater with high pollution degree in the early stage is collected through the first rainwater collecting pool, then detecting, collecting, purifying and discharging are carried out on clear rainwater in the middle and later stages through all the sensors, thesecond rainwater collecting pool, the rainwater purifying pool and the rainwater discharging pool, so that the sampling detection accuracy is improved, and the integration of rainwater collection, detection, purification and discharge is realized.
